Less Time on Charts, More Time With Patients

Doctors do not enter the field of medicine to spend their days writing notes. Yet in many clinics, charting can take up just as much time as seeing patients. AI can change that. With smart tools that transcribe conversations and build accurate documentation, charting becomes faster and more natural.

Instead of typing during or after appointments, providers can speak freely while the AI listens and captures key points. Some tools even suggest summaries, fill in structured data, or highlight missing elements. The result is less time at the keyboard and more eye contact with patients. That change alone improves the experience for everyone in the room.

Smarter Scheduling and Staff Coordination

AI does more than write notes. Many practices now use it to streamline scheduling, reduce no-shows, and improve staff coordination. By analyzing patterns in patient visits, AI tools can recommend better appointment slots, predict cancelations, and optimize daily calendars.

These systems help front desk teams avoid overbooking or underutilizing providers. They also allow for quick adjustments when things change. Staff can spend less time managing the schedule and more time assisting patients. The flow of the day feels smoother, and stress levels drop for everyone.

Better Communication and Follow-Up

Patients forget things. Doctors are human. But AI tools can fill in those gaps. Many practices use automated systems to send appointment reminders, post-visit instructions, or test results. These tools ensure that patients stay informed without requiring the team to call or email each person individually.

AI-powered messaging systems can even flag patients who are overdue for follow-ups or who might need a medication refill soon. This proactive communication helps with patient retention and keeps care on track. It also shows patients that the practice is organized and attentive.

Improved Billing and Fewer Errors

One of the most frustrating parts of running a practice is dealing with billing errors and claims rejections. AI can help reduce these issues by ensuring that documentation is complete, codes are accurate, and notes support billing requirements.

Some systems can check notes in real time, alerting providers to missing elements before a claim is submitted. Others review claims after submission and suggest corrections. Either way, the result is cleaner billing, fewer denials, and faster payments. Practices can retain more of the revenue they earn, without increasing their administrative load.

Training and Onboarding Made Easier

Bringing new team members up to speed can be a time-consuming process. AI tools can help by providing smart training support. Some systems use past data and interactions to help new staff understand common workflows, frequently asked questions, or preferred communication styles.

Instead of relying on a team member to explain everything, AI can offer real-time suggestions, walkthroughs, or tips based on the situation. This shortens the learning curve and builds confidence faster. It also ensures that patient care remains consistent even when the team is growing or changing.

Room for Growth Without Burnout

Perhaps the most powerful benefit of AI in medical practices is its ability to support growth without adding pressure. Many clinics want to expand services, increase patient volume, or explore new care models. But growth often leads to burnout if the systems behind it are not efficient.

AI gives practices room to grow by absorbing the extra work. Whether it is documentation, scheduling, or patient engagement, the right tools make it easier to scale up without overwhelming the team. That means providers can care for more people without compromising the balance and quality that drew them to medicine in the first place.
